Hot Stone Massage is more relaxing, it is still therapeutic but has more focus also on the relaxation aspect. Basalt Rock Stones are heated in my hot towel cabby then I hold the stones as I massage over your muscles throughout the whole massage. The heat helps warm up the muscles before I try to work out the tense areas. It feels pretty nice and I recommend everyone to try it at least once. Aside from hot stones I also have moist heat packs which work differently than the hot stones. Hot packs are free of charge. This is a moist heat versus dry heat because the packs are soaked in very hot water then placed in terry cover and towels (to provide some layers between your body and the heat) this is a deeper penetrating heat to one surface area. The pack is left in place for about 20minutes versus the hot stones just cross over your skin fairly quickly. Both Hot Stone and Heat packs are really nice to warm up during the changing season.

If you normally book directly through me instead of online then please just let me know if you want to try one of these. Cupping helps free up the fascia layers from muscle through suction. Rockblade is an instrument asissted soft tissue manipulation I use more to break up stubborn adhesions, taut bands and trigger points.
